AI Summary

  • Establishes a transportation electrification study committee consisting of 14 members including state legislators, the director of the department of transportation, environmental and nonprofit representatives, an electric vehicle manufacturer representative, three electric utility representatives, and local government officials.

  • Committee is directed to review state laws affecting transportation electrification, create public outreach campaigns to educate the public about electric vehicles and their benefits, and collaborate with local governments, utilities, environmental groups, and the transportation industry to promote the transition from carbon-fueled to electric vehicles.

  • Committee must submit a report to the governor, president of the senate, and speaker of the house of representatives on or before July 1, 2024, detailing its activities and recommendations for administrative or legislative action.

  • Committee includes two senate members and two house members from different political parties, with each chamber designating one member to serve as cochairperson.

  • The committee is automatically repealed on September 30, 2025.
